### Step 2: Cut over the thumbnail queue

Quick one for the sync: we're moving Pixelbarn's thumbnail generation off the old cron-based batcher onto the new ThumbForge queue. The old system polled every five minutes, which is why previews lagged after uploads; the new queue processes events as they land. Before flipping the switch, drain the legacy batcher, confirm zero in-flight jobs, and then point the upload handler at ThumbForge. Once that's done, apply the settings below to the ThumbForge workers. The required configuration values follow.

service settings:
novath:
  pin: 1396
  tenant: pelys
  seal: seal_ccc035e1
  metrics_host: metrics.novath.qorvelworks.test
  standby_team: fraeth
  escalation: drueth-zorok
  nonce: 61d508

Subject: Handover — Metricast sidecar releases

Welcome aboard. I'm rotating off the Metricast metrics-aggregation sidecar; you own releases starting Monday. Process: cut from release/stable, run the smoke suite, tag, push to the Vantorix registry. Pipeline config lives in ops/metricast-deploy. Dashboards are under the Obsview tenant. Rollbacks: redeploy previous tag, never patch in place. Flag anything odd to the platform channel before shipping. You'll need the deploy key for registry pushes, so here it is.

rollout seal: bky4_x7Gc

**Mgmt Meeting Minutes — Retiring the Brightline Range**

Quick recap for sales leads at Fenholt Supplies: we agreed to retire the Brightline fixture range by year-end. Remaining stock moves to clearance pricing next month, and accounts on standing orders get migrated to the Lumetta range. Trade-in incentives were approved in principle. The confidential note on next steps sits just below.

board note of bajof-bajeg: The pricing group signed off on a budget of $13.4 million for Project Sildor. The renewal with Lamixek Holdings closes at $48.9 million a year, 49 percent above the last contract.

Leadership Review Briefing — Loyalty Programme Overhaul

Finance team: the Kestrel Rewards overhaul replaces tiered points with flat cashback, cutting accrual liability by an estimated 18% over two years. Redemption costs shift to quarterly recognition, simplifying reserves. Migration begins after the Marlow pilot concludes. Budget impact is within the approved envelope. The confidential note below outlines the commercial rationale.

confidential, yajep-kadup: Only 5 of the 80 pilot accounts renewed Oliix, so a churn review is set for January 15.